T.J. Maxx commonly known as TJ Maxx is a chain of department stores and is one of the largest US close retailers. The chain has a wide variety of products which include clothes, bedding, shoes, giftware as well as furniture. Combined with Sierra Trading Post, HomeGoods, Marshalls, HomeSense, Winners, and T.K. Maxx, TJX holds the largest discount clothing store in America. Bernard Cammarata founded T.J. Maxx in 1976, and at present, the company is operating more than 1,000 stores in the United States.

History of T.J. Maxx

T.J. Maxx was started in 1976 by Bernard Cammarata in Massachusetts, who worked for Marshalls as a merchandising head before starting the business. Zayre was a discount department stores chain that hired Cammarata to inaugurate a rival chain. Their concept proved fruitful that in 1988, Zayre sold the namesake chain to Ames, a rival store.

By December 1988, a restructuring plan was announced by Zayre and this is how TJX Companies incorporated. Marshals were bought by TJX in 1995, and in the fall of 1998, T.J. Maxx opened AJ Wright, a chain of stores, but the chain was closed in 2007. An e-commerce site by TJX was started in 2019 that sold handbags in the start, and later on, their range of items expanded to include clothing, shoes, and other accessories. T.J. Maxx is known as T.K. Maxx in UK, Germany, Netherlands, and Poland.

Key Facts

  • T.J. Maxx always focuses its marketing efforts to help people find what they want without spending much money somewhere else. There is no doubt that the company offers some very good deals and people go there knowing that they will get pretty much anything at a very low price.
  • T.J. Maxx sells a lot of clothing, but this is not the only item sold by them. At T.J. Maxx, you will be able to find handbags, clothing, kitchen utensils, and even toys.
  • T.J. Maxx commences its operations in the United States and Puerto Rico, but their parent company TJX operates in different countries of the world.

Why T.J. Maxx is so cheap?

Many strategies are used by T.J. Maxx to keep its prices low. Much of it comes down to the way the merchandise is purchased by it. The stock is purchased from the manufacturers that make too much and those department stores that overbuy.

Which company owns T.J. Maxx?

TJX Companies basically owns T.J. Maxx. Other than that, the company also owns many brands like HomeGoods, Marshalls, HomeSense, and more.
